| 19 | package com.googlecode.lanterna; |
| 20 | |
| 21 | /** |
| 22 | * Terminal dimensions in 2-d space, measured in number of rows and columns. This class is immutable and cannot change |
| 23 | * its internal state after creation. |
| 24 | * |
| 25 | * @author Martin |
| 26 | */ |
| 27 | public class TerminalSize { |
| 28 | public static final TerminalSize ZERO = new TerminalSize(0, 0); |
| 29 | public static final TerminalSize ONE = new TerminalSize(1, 1); |
| 30 | |
| 31 | private final int columns; |
| 32 | private final int rows; |
| 33 | |
| 34 | /** |
| 35 | * Creates a new terminal size representation with a given width (columns) and height (rows) |
| 36 | * @param columns Width, in number of columns |
| 37 | * @param rows Height, in number of columns |
| 38 | */ |
| 39 | public TerminalSize(int columns, int rows) { |
| 40 | if (columns < 0) { |
| 41 | throw new IllegalArgumentException("TerminalSize.columns cannot be less than 0!"); |
| 42 | } |
| 43 | if (rows < 0) { |
| 44 | throw new IllegalArgumentException("TerminalSize.rows cannot be less than 0!"); |
| 45 | } |
| 46 | this.columns = columns; |
| 47 | this.rows = rows; |
| 48 | } |
| 49 | |
| 50 | /** |
| 51 | * @return Returns the width of this size representation, in number of columns |
| 52 | */ |
| 53 | public int getColumns() { |
| 54 | return columns; |
| 55 | } |
| 56 | |
| 57 | /** |
| 58 | * Creates a new size based on this size, but with a different width |
| 59 | * @param columns Width of the new size, in columns |
| 60 | * @return New size based on this one, but with a new width |
| 61 | */ |
| 62 | public TerminalSize withColumns(int columns) { |
| 63 | if(this.columns == columns) { |
| 64 | return this; |
| 65 | } |
| 66 | if(columns == 0 && this.rows == 0) { |
| 67 | return ZERO; |
| 68 | } |
| 69 | return new TerminalSize(columns, this.rows); |
| 70 | } |
| 71 | |
| 72 | |
| 73 | /** |
| 74 | * @return Returns the height of this size representation, in number of rows |
| 75 | */ |
| 76 | public int getRows() { |
| 77 | return rows; |
| 78 | } |
| 79 | |
| 80 | /** |
| 81 | * Creates a new size based on this size, but with a different height |
| 82 | * @param rows Height of the new size, in rows |
| 83 | * @return New size based on this one, but with a new height |
| 84 | */ |
| 85 | public TerminalSize withRows(int rows) { |
| 86 | if(this.rows == rows) { |
| 87 | return this; |
| 88 | } |
| 89 | if(rows == 0 && this.columns == 0) { |
| 90 | return ZERO; |
| 91 | } |
| 92 | return new TerminalSize(this.columns, rows); |
| 93 | } |
| 94 | |
| 95 | /** |
| 96 | * Creates a new TerminalSize object representing a size with the same number of rows, but with a column size offset by a |
| 97 | * supplied value. Calling this method with delta 0 will return this, calling it with a positive delta will return |
| 98 | * a terminal size <i>delta</i> number of columns wider and for negative numbers shorter. |
| 99 | * @param delta Column offset |
| 100 | * @return New terminal size based off this one but with an applied transformation |
| 101 | */ |
| 102 | public TerminalSize withRelativeColumns(int delta) { |
| 103 | if(delta == 0) { |
| 104 | return this; |
| 105 | } |
| 106 | return withColumns(columns + delta); |
| 107 | } |
| 108 | |
| 109 | /** |
| 110 | * Creates a new TerminalSize object representing a size with the same number of columns, but with a row size offset by a |
| 111 | * supplied value. Calling this method with delta 0 will return this, calling it with a positive delta will return |
| 112 | * a terminal size <i>delta</i> number of rows longer and for negative numbers shorter. |
| 113 | * @param delta Row offset |
| 114 | * @return New terminal size based off this one but with an applied transformation |
| 115 | */ |
| 116 | public TerminalSize withRelativeRows(int delta) { |
| 117 | if(delta == 0) { |
| 118 | return this; |
| 119 | } |
| 120 | return withRows(rows + delta); |
| 121 | } |
| 122 | |
| 123 | /** |
| 124 | * Creates a new TerminalSize object representing a size based on this object's size but with a delta applied. |
| 125 | * This is the same as calling |
| 126 | * <code>withRelativeColumns(delta.getColumns()).withRelativeRows(delta.getRows())</code> |
| 127 | * @param delta Column and row offset |
| 128 | * @return New terminal size based off this one but with an applied resize |
| 129 | */ |
| 130 | public TerminalSize withRelative(TerminalSize delta) { |
| 131 | return withRelative(delta.getColumns(), delta.getRows()); |
| 132 | } |
| 133 | |
| 134 | /** |
| 135 | * Creates a new TerminalSize object representing a size based on this object's size but with a delta applied. |
| 136 | * This is the same as calling |
| 137 | * <code>withRelativeColumns(deltaColumns).withRelativeRows(deltaRows)</code> |
| 138 | * @param deltaColumns How many extra columns the new TerminalSize will have (negative values are allowed) |
| 139 | * @param deltaRows How many extra rows the new TerminalSize will have (negative values are allowed) |
| 140 | * @return New terminal size based off this one but with an applied resize |
| 141 | */ |
| 142 | public TerminalSize withRelative(int deltaColumns, int deltaRows) { |
| 143 | return withRelativeRows(deltaRows).withRelativeColumns(deltaColumns); |
| 144 | } |
| 145 | |
| 146 | /** |
| 147 | * Takes a different TerminalSize and returns a new TerminalSize that has the largest dimensions of the two, |
| 148 | * measured separately. So calling 3x5 on a 5x3 will return 5x5. |
| 149 | * @param other Other TerminalSize to compare with |
| 150 | * @return TerminalSize that combines the maximum width between the two and the maximum height |
| 151 | */ |
| 152 | public TerminalSize max(TerminalSize other) { |
| 153 | return withColumns(Math.max(columns, other.columns)) |
| 154 | .withRows(Math.max(rows, other.rows)); |
| 155 | } |
| 156 | |
| 157 | /** |
| 158 | * Takes a different TerminalSize and returns a new TerminalSize that has the smallest dimensions of the two, |
| 159 | * measured separately. So calling 3x5 on a 5x3 will return 3x3. |
| 160 | * @param other Other TerminalSize to compare with |
| 161 | * @return TerminalSize that combines the minimum width between the two and the minimum height |
| 162 | */ |
| 163 | public TerminalSize min(TerminalSize other) { |
| 164 | return withColumns(Math.min(columns, other.columns)) |
| 165 | .withRows(Math.min(rows, other.rows)); |
| 166 | } |
| 167 | |
| 168 | /** |
| 169 | * Returns itself if it is equal to the supplied size, otherwise the supplied size. You can use this if you have a |
| 170 | * size field which is frequently recalculated but often resolves to the same size; it will keep the same object |
| 171 | * in memory instead of swapping it out every cycle. |
| 172 | * @param size Size you want to return |
| 173 | * @return Itself if this size equals the size passed in, otherwise the size passed in |
| 174 | */ |
| 175 | public TerminalSize with(TerminalSize size) { |
| 176 | if(equals(size)) { |
| 177 | return this; |
| 178 | } |
| 179 | return size; |
| 180 | } |
| 181 | |
| 182 | @Override |
| 183 | public String toString() { |
| 184 | return "{" + columns + "x" + rows + "}"; |
| 185 | } |
| 186 | |
| 187 | @Override |
| 188 | public boolean equals(Object obj) { |
| 189 | if(this == obj) { |
| 190 | return true; |
| 191 | } |
| 192 | if (!(obj instanceof TerminalSize)) { |
| 193 | return false; |
| 194 | } |
| 195 | |
| 196 | TerminalSize other = (TerminalSize) obj; |
| 197 | return columns == other.columns |
| 198 | && rows == other.rows; |
| 199 | } |
| 200 | |
| 201 | @Override |
| 202 | public int hashCode() { |
| 203 | int hash = 5; |
| 204 | hash = 53 * hash + this.columns; |
| 205 | hash = 53 * hash + this.rows; |
| 206 | return hash; |
| 207 | } |
| 208 | } |
